Website schema describes structured information that assists search engines analyze the details on websites better. By using schema markup-- a particular vocabulary of tags (or microdata)-- you essentially supply a roadmap for search engines.
Schema was presented in 2011 as a collective effort in between significant search engines like Google, Bing, Yahoo!, and Yandex. It intended to What is WebSite Schema standardize how webmasters mark up their material to help online search engine understand it better. Since then, it's evolved significantly.
When you execute schema on your site, you're including an extra layer of details that helps search engine crawlers in understanding the context of your material. For instance, if you have a recipe on your website, schema can define information like cooking time or ingredients.

One of the most substantial advantages of carrying out schema is enhanced visibility in SERPs (Online Search Engine Outcomes Pages). Rich snippets-- those elegant little boxes with extra info-- get attention and motivate clicks.
Rich snippets often result in higher CTRs due to the fact that they provide users with more context about what they can anticipate from your page. Research studies have actually shown that pages with rich snippets can attain as much as 30% greater click rates!
Schema enables better targeting by helping specify what kind of material you're showcasing. Whether it's articles, products, evaluations, or occasions-- schema provides clarity.

First things first-- decide which type(s) of schema apply to your site. Is it a short article? A product page? Understanding this will assist your implementation process.

Once you have actually selected a format, start crafting your markup code according to the selected schema type. The Schema.org website has comprehensive documentation that makes this process smoother than butter on a hot skillet!
Before going live, you'll wish to guarantee whatever looks great under the hood! Usage Google's Structured Data Testing Tool or Rich Results Check tool to confirm that your markup is error-free.
After screening successfully, it's time to integrate the markup into your site! If you're using WordPress or another CMS (Material Management System), there might be plugins readily available that streamline this action even further.

1. What is structured data? Structured information refers to standardized formats that assist search engines comprehend what's on a web page more effectively through specific vocabularies such as schema markup.
2. Will implementing schema warranty much better rankings? While carrying out schema improves visibility and CTRs possibly causing improved rankings indirectly, it doesn't ensure them outright as lots of other aspects affect SEO performance too!
3. Can I utilize several types of schemas on one page? Absolutely! Simply make sure they matter; for instance, an article about a product evaluation might integrate both Short article and Product schemas seamlessly.
4. Is there a cost connected with implementing site schemas? Nope! Executing structured data doesn't cost anything beyond possible development resources if you're not doing it yourself.
5. Exist any dangers involved with utilizing structured data? The main threat depends on improperly increased schemas which could lead Google not showing rich bits at all or worse yet punishing your website due to spammy implementations!
6. How long does it consider abundant bits from schemas to appear after implementation? Modifications may take anywhere from days weeks depending upon how frequently Google crawls your website; perseverance is key here!
